European shares poised to open higher as global trade holds spotlight

European equities are poised for a slightly positive open, with DAX futures up 0.17% and CAC 40 futures gaining 0.15%, while London's FTSE 100 futures hover near the flatline, indicating a generally modest upward bias for regional shares at the start of the trading week.

Analysis

European equity markets are poised for a slightly positive open, with pre-market indicators pointing to modest gains. Futures tied to Germany's DAX index are trading 0.17% higher, while those for France's CAC 40 show a similar increase of 0.15%, suggesting a mildly optimistic sentiment for continental European shares at the start of the week. In contrast, London's FTSE 100 futures are exhibiting more tepid momentum, hovering just above the flatline. The fractional nature of these gains indicates a lack of a strong directional catalyst, signaling a potentially cautious and quiet start to the trading session across the region.
